How much do records ass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for records assistant in Mobile, AL is $18.43,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.29 and $20.05 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a records ass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Records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of records management principles,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with electronic document management systems (EDMS), data entry software, and office productivity tools like Microsoft Office is typically required. Excellent time management, discretion, and effective communication are important soft skills for handling sensitive information and collaborating with colleagues. These abilities ensure records are accurately maintained, secure, and easily accessible, supporting efficient organizational operations and compliance.

The main difference between a Records Assistant and a Data Entry Clerk lies in their focus. Records Assistants manage and organize physical or digital records, ensuring proper filing and retrieval, often in administrative or archival settings. Data Entry Clerks primarily input and update data into computer systems, emphasizing speed and accuracy. While both roles require similar basic qualifications, Records Assistants typically handle more document management tasks, whereas Data Entry Clerks focus on data accuracy and processing.

What are some common challenges records assistants face when managing both physical and digital records?

Records Assistants often encounter the challenge of maintaining consistency and accuracy across both physical and electronic filing systems. This includes ensuring documents are correctly categorized, securely stored, and easily retrievable while adhering to data privacy policies. Additionally, transitioning from paper-based systems to digital archives can require learning new software and adapting to updated processes, all while balancing daily responsibilities. Effective communication with team members and attention to detail are key to overcoming these challenges.

What is a records assistant?

Records Assistants are administrative professionals responsible for organizing, maintaining, and retrieving physical or digital records for an organization. They ensure that documents are accurately filed, easily accessible, and comply with data protection and retention policies. Their duties may include data entry, document scanning, responding to information requests, and supporting records management systems. Records Assistants play a crucial role in helping organizations maintain efficient and compliant recordkeeping processes.

Job description

JOB SUMMARY: The Medical Assistant, under the supervision of the unit supervisor or Nurse Manager, provides a variety of medical and clerical duties associated with patient care.  The Medical Assistant maintains a pleasant, courteous and cooperative manner with patients, visitors and Center's personnel.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S: 

  • Maintains confidentiality at all times.
  • Work up patients and record vital signs, weights and chief complaints on progress notes at each visit.
  • Make sure all lab results are on charts before giving chart to health care provider.
  • Record patients' name and chart number on all pages in the medical records.
  • Assist patients in exam rooms.  Assist nurses and/or provider with procedures and treatments.
  • Administer medication as ordered by providers, under the supervision of the provider and/or registered nurse.
  • Assist nurses with mailing of correspondences to patients for abnormal lab and missed appointments and document actions in patient's medical record.
  • Maintain and organize supplies in the supply room.  Keep exam room stocked and organized at all times.
  • Cover lab personnel when the lab technician is out.
  • Rotates to other units and departments (i.e., front desk, x-ray, laboratory, etc.) when deemed necessary by immediate supervisor or Director of Nursing.
  • Maintain up-to-date CPR Certification and submit a copy of CPR card to the personnel department. 
  • Participate in the nurse training sessions, maintain CEU's as required by the State Nurses Licensure Board.
  • Any other duties deemed necessary by immediate supervisor and/or Nurse Manager

ADDITIONAL RESPONSIBILITIES:

Pediatrics:

  • Assist with ear irrigations, eye and hearing screening.

OB/GYN:

  • Sterilize surgical instruments.
  • Log all urine results on charts.
  • Issue family planning supplies and assist with completing family planning forms.
  • Maintains reception area in neat and orderly condition at all times.
  • Prompt arrival and regular attendance at work.
  • Sorts all office mail.  Responsible for incoming mail and outgoing mail distribution.          

The above reflects the general duties considered necessary to describe the principal functions of the job and shall not be considered as a detailed description of all work that may be assigned by the immediate supervisor, Nurse Manager and/or health care provider of that may be inherent in the position as it relates to each specialty group (i.e., Family Medicine, Internal Medicine, Pediatrics, OB/GYN, etc.)

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:  High school graduate or GED equivalent.  Graduate of an approved Medical Assistant Program or an equivalent combination of training, education and work experience relative to the position.  Must have pleasant personality, good telephone etiquette and public relations skills.  One or more years work experience in medical setting with knowledge of medical terminology, CPT coding, and Medicaid, Medicare, and other third party insurance carriers billing experience.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ES:  Requires knowledge of the field of assignment sufficient to perform thoroughly and accurately the full scope of responsibility as illustrated by example in the above job description.  Requires human relations skills to deal effectively with patients/visitors in person or via telephone.  Must have keyboard experience and have knowledge in medical records and insurance billing.   Basic ability to operate a multi-line telephone, copier, adding machine, fax machine and other office equipment.

CERTIFICATION,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S:  CPR, CMA, RMA.
